Ipmi bmc device driver

Employing a straight forward driver scanner application has developed into a standard technique within the last year or two. If both drivers are installed, a resource conflict with the communication to the bmc baseboard. I am looking at a reported issue on two me enclosures. Bmc utilities accompany dells baseboard management controllers bmc to extend their remote management and scripting capabilities. Ipmidrv 1004 errors on windows 2008 r2 m600 blades.

Ipmi driver does not obtain sensor information in windows server 2012 r2. It is intelligent in a manner of speaking, anyway because it requires a processor besides the main processor that is always on and maintaining the system. If both drivers are installed, a resource conflict with the communication to the bmc baseboard management controller occurs and results in unreliable operation. The solproxy allows the servers serial console to be redirected to a remote client.

The bmc provides various interfaces that are needed for monitoring the health of the system hardware. Ipmi let remote administrators monitor the health of servers, deploy or remove software, manage hardware peripherals like the keyboard and mouse, reboot the system and update software on it, independent of the operating system. The baseboard management controller bmc provides the intelligence in the ipmi architecture. By downloading, you agree to the terms and conditions of the hewlett packard enterprise software license agreement. The ast2400 is designed to dedicatedly support the pcie x1 bus interface. Apr 01, 2011 recommended hp integrity baseboard management controller ipmi device driver for windows sever 2008 r2 on itaniumbased systems. M620 servers, warning in logs, event id 1004 ipmidrv. It may also be possible the available cipher suite ids are not correctly configured on the remote bmc. Eventid 1004 from ipmidrv v2 blackcat reasearch facility.

A device driver that goes into the linux kernel, and a user. By default, installing windows server 2003 r2 does not install the hardware management component. The supermicro x9 platforms baseboard management controller bmc is built on nuvoton wpcm450 controller. For more information on ipmb and the format of an ipmb message, refer to the ipmb and ipmi specifications. Ipmi driver does not obtain sensor information in windows. Description, the ipmi device driver attempted to communicate with the ipmi bmc device during device creation.

Ipmi driver conflicts in windows server 2003 r2 intel. Recommended hp integrity baseboard management controller ipmi device driver for windows sever 2008 r2 on itaniumbased systems. The ipmi promoters encourage equipment vendors and it managers to consider a more modern systems management interface which can provide better security, scalability, and features for existing datacenters and be supported on the requisite platforms and devices. Avocent ipmi device driver download the bmc monitors the sensors and can send alerts to a system administrator via the network if any of the parameters do not stay within preset limits, avocent ipmi device driver download the bmc monitors the sensors and can send alerts to a system administrator via the network if any of the parameters do. Aug, 2014 fixes a problem in which the ipmi driver does not obtain sensor information in a windows server 2012 or windows 8 environment. As a messagebased, hardwarelevel interface specification, ipmi operates. The frequency may vary from a couple of messages per day upwards to several messages per minute. The currently available inband drivers are kcs, ssif, openipmi, and sunbmc. The ipmi device driver attempted to communicate with the ipmi bmc device during device creation. Intelligent platform management interface wikipedia. The system event log is overflowing with eventid 1004 from ipmidrv. If you need access 37 from userland, you need to select device interface for ipmi if you 38 want access through a device driver. Please update to the latest aspeed vga driver in your os before upgrading ipmi firmware v3.

Generated on 2019mar29 from project linux revision v5. It may be recommended not to accept a manually operated revise of the specific driver, but alternatively to pay attention to the completely archive seeking drivers that had been broken by your identified flawed microsoft generic ipmi compliant device. Open the system devices node and locate microsoft generic ipmi compliant device. You do not need the ipmi service nor the winrm listener to use other applications such as ipmiutil. This is the hp ipmi device driver hp baseboard management controller bmc device driver or the health driver windows server 2008 r2 on hp integrity servers. Ipmi management utilities ipmiutildevelopers ipmiutil in. The microsoft intelligent platform management interface ipmi driver and wmi ipmi provider supply data from baseboard management controller bmc operations to the operating system. Some software requires a valid warranty, current hewlett packard enterprise support contract, or a license fee. Driveraddress should be prefixed with 0x for a hex value and 0 for an octal value. Driver address should be prefixed with 0x for a hex value and 0 for an octal value. As i understand it, the winrm listener is a ms service that goes with sce. Could not open device at devipmi0 or devipmi0 or devipmidev0.

A device driver that goes into the linux kernel, and a userlevel library that provides a higherlevel abstraction of ipmi and generic services that can be used on any operation system. This patch adds the product id to the driver model platform device name, in addition to the device id. It is a specialized microcontroller embedded on the motherboard of a computer generally a server. The supermicro x10 platforms baseboard management controller bmc is built on the aspeed ast 2400 controller. Contribute to torvaldslinux development by creating an account on github. To install the microsoft ipmi device driver, complete the following steps. For more information about ipmi classes, see intelligent platform management interface ipmi classes. Hp baseboard management controller ipmi device err. The ip address or hostname of the bmc other options may be needed to match the configuration of the bmc, the following options are optional, but in. The ipmi spec does not require that individual bmcs in a system have unique devices ids, but it. Event id 1004 ipmi driver functionality windows 2012 std. If the ipmi device is dynamically loaded, then the output must be similar to the following. From the windows desktop, click start control panel add or remove programs.

Different types of sensors built into the computer system. Intelligent platform management interface ipmi is a standardized messagebased hardware management interface. If you do see the device file output, then the ipmi driver is configured, and you can ignore the following step. The currently available inband drivers are kcs, ssif, openipmi. You can increase the timeouts associated with the ipmi device driver. Supermicro baseboard management controller bmc must support intelligent platform management interface ipmi version 2. The following options are general options for configuring ipmi communication and executing general tool commands. For more information about driver installation, see installation and configuration for windows remote management.

Fixes a problem in which the ipmi driver does not obtain sensor information in a windows server 2012 or windows 8. Type device manager and click enter to open the device manager window. Thus any tool like ipmitool will fail could not open device at devipmi0 or dev ipmi 0 or devipmidev0. Do not probe inband ipmi devices for default settings. The satellite controllers within the same chassis connect to the bmc via the. Either the configured timeouts are too small and the ipmi bmc device responses take longer than the timeouts, or the bmc has a technical fault. This new pair offers an openipmi compatible driver ipmi and a legacy bmc compatible driver, sbmc, both of which can be used at the same time. Code 10 the io device is configured incorrectly or the configuration parameters to the driver are incorrect. Used to target a specific bmc on a multinode, multibmc system through the ipmi device driver interface.

Nov 23, 2016 the ipmi device driver attempted to communicate with the ipmi bmc device during normal operation. This automated test validates various features of a baseboard management controller bmc with the intelligent platform management interface ipmi protocol. Listed below are general ipmi options, tool specific options, trouble shooting information, workaround information, examples, and known issues. The bmc sends ipmi requests to a device usually a satellite management controller or satellite mc via ipmb and the device sends a response back to the bmc. Jun 20, 2016 the ipmi device driver attempted to communicate with the ipmi bmc device during normal operation. Openipmi openipmi is an effort to create a fullfunction ipmi system to allow full access to all ipmi information on a server and to abstract it to a level that will make it easy to use. Description bmcinfo displays bmc information, such as device version numbers, device support, and globally unique ids guids. Precautions when using windows server 2012 r2 2000 fujitsu. Ipmi shell and ipmi tool allow local and remote ipmi. Supermicro ipmi utilities supermicro server management. The ipmi device driver attempted to communicate with the ipmi bmc. Device42 can discover a device via its ipmibmc idrac, ilo etc. California drivers license expires in may, how can i get a realid without visiting a.

This can be avoided by increasing the timeouts and applying patch. The currently available inband drivers are kcs, ssif, openipmi, sunbmc, and inteldcmi. The intelligent platform management interface ipmi is a set of computer interface. To perform some advanced sel management, please see bmc device 8. Ipmi requires hardware access that cannot be logically hypervised. Ipmi interface with ml350 g6 and windows server 20. An operating systems scheduler granularity may be larger than the time it takes to perform a ipmi transaction, thus the wall clock time of the kcs driver is far. The current version of ipmi firmware used on the cde250 is v1. If there is no exclamation mark, the driver has loaded successfully. The bmc baseboard management controller is a component found on most server motherboards. Recommended hpe recommends users update to this version at their earliest convenience.

Registering a node with the ipmi driver nodes configured to use the ipmitool drivers should have the driver field set to ipmi. Eventid 1004 from ipmidrv blackcat reasearch facility. If your system 41 properly provides the smbios info for ipmi, the driver will detect it 42 and just work. A nice overview of ipmi can be found here, if you are interested. The following is an example of configuring bmc using ipmitool version 1. Specify the inband driver device path to be used instead of the probed path. The ipmi driver is a wdm kernel mode driver that communicates with the bmc using kcs keyboard controller style. Microsoft generic ipmi compliant device driver downloads. Any ipmi interaction you would be doing would be the client on the guest os connecting to its available physical hardware which is really a service to a device that is listening to connections while the ipmidev is loaded in the kernel. Ipmi and nowstandard hardware called a baseboard management controller bmc let remote administrators monitor the health of servers. Ipmi stands for intelligent platform management interface. The ipmi intelligent platform management interface drivers for microsoft and intel products should not be loaded at the same time.

The ipmi device driver attempted to communicate with the ipmi bmc device during. The microsoft intelligent platform management interface ipmi driver. We get the message saying that staring ipmi driver failed when we start up openmanage. Event id 1004 ipmi driver functionality windows 2012. The support function is refusing to take on these servers, saying they are concerned by a warning in the windows logs, event id 1004 ipmidrv the ipmi device driver attempted to communicate with the ipmi bmc device during normal operation.

Device42 can discover a device via its ipmi bmc idrac, ilo etc. Included in the bmc utility package are serial over lan proxy solproxy, ipmi shell ipmish, and the open source ipmi tool. In most systems with ipmi, you can monitor and maintain the. It appears in the device manager as microsoft smbios generic ipmi compliant device. Ipmi interface with ml350 g6 and windows server 2012 im installing windows server 2012 standard on an hp ml350 g6, but i can not install the ipmi interface device, already used all the resources of sum, used the spp 2012 and version 2008 r2 x64 addtional on the hp website, but does not install, can someone help me. The ipmi device driver attempted to communicate with the ipmi bmc device during normal operation.

From the component list, select management and monitoring tools, and then click details. Hp baseboard management controller ipmi device in device manager has the following status. If you want the extended features of the new openipmi driver, but still require legacy bmc driver functionality you have the choice of using the new sbmcipmi driver module pair. There are currently three 3 known problems associated with the ipmi bmc subsystem and the ipmi fw version 1. Internally the ipmi kernel driver chooses to spin while polling for a response from the base management controller bmc while the kcs driver elects to sleep between poll attempts.

No further updates to the ipmi specification are planned or should be expected. At the core of the ipmi is a hardware chip that is known as the baseboard management controller bmc, or management controller mc. Supermicro intelligent management ipmi supermicro server. The error will say the ipmi device driver attempted to communicate with the ipmi bmc device during normal operation. You can use this utility to perform ipmi functions with a kernel device driver or over a lan interface. The bmc manages the interface between systemmanagement software and platform hardware. Note whether there is an exclamation mark beside the device name. Mar 11, 2020 intelligent platform management interface ipmi is a standardized messagebased hardware management interface. Precautions when using windows server 2012 r2 2000.

705 751 851 1072 933 130 110 27 309 849 1392 1316 472 922 1219 901 73 1074 214 1483 101 1195 340 1436 857 542 956 609 714 780 1396 754 140 15 398 1282 558 1099 1324